Political corruption and petty corruption remains a significant problem in Romania, even
if there were some positive results in terms of high-level corruption cases. 25 percent of
Romanians they maintain that they were asked, explicitly or tacitly, to pay a bribe in the last year,
this is the second (after the Lithuanians, with 29 percent) the highest percentage in the EU. The
highest perception of corruption in Romania, 67 percent recorded in the following areas: police,
customs and health, the opposite being, 15 percent, financial institutions and banking and 16
percent, private companies .
Because DNA surveys, nearly half of large cities in Romania, mayors no longer in office.
21 municipalities of the 48 largest local institutions - capital cities and sectors (41 counties and
seven municipalities of Bucharest) are issued by mayors, suspended for corruption. These
mayors, elected in June 2012 have various criminal matters: convicted, in custody or judicial
control, are indicted, prosecuted or declared incompatible. "The mayor's mandate is suspended
by law only if it has been taken into custody" by order of the prefect, provides local government
law. If the mayor is suspended, his duties are taken over by one of the deputy mayors, chosen by
a secret ballot of local councilors. With few exceptions, 2015 was the year that most arrests
occurred among mayors Romania.
Between 1990-March 2016 they were convicted for corruption eight mayors of major
cities (listed above) and 6 of Bucharest district mayor and 61 high-ranking politicians (MPs or
members of government).
